Assay Detail

CHEMBL3372144

Review assay metadata, readout intent, target linkage, and publication context from the same page.

Binding
Antagonist activity against human D2LR expressed in CHOK1 cells assessed as inhibition of pergolide-induced beta-arrestin translocation by beta-galactosidase based beta-arrestin recruitment assay
16
Total Activities
16
Compounds Tested
1
Activity Types
0
Assay Parameters

Assay Information

Assay Type Binding
Organism Homo sapiens
Cell Type CHO-K1
Confidence 9 — Direct single protein target
Curated By Autocuration

Target

D(2) dopamine receptor (CHEMBL217)
Type SINGLE PROTEIN
Organism Homo sapiens

Publication

Design, synthesis, and structure-activity relationship studies of a series of [4-(4-carboxamidobutyl)]-1-arylpiperazines: insights into structural features contributing to dopamine D3 versus D2 receptor subtype selectivity.
Ananthan S, Saini SK, Zhou G, Hobrath JV, Padmalayam I, Zhai L, Bostwick JR, Antonio T, Reith ME, McDowell S, Cho E, McAleer L, Taylor M, Luedtke RR.
J Med Chem (2014) 57 : 7042 -7060
PubMed 25126833 · DOI
